    The Wagakki Band is an eight-piece band that began with the main vocalist Yuko Suzuhana's desire to present Japanese classical performing arts to the world with a more POP image. They have always been obsessed with the number eight, as it has always been a lucky number in Japan, and they considered this concert, commemorating their eighth anniversary, to be an important milestone. Unfortunately, it has been announced that the Wagakki Band will cease its activities indefinitely at the end of this year, the band's 10th anniversary.
